"Kameo: Elements of Power" and "Mafia" are two distinct video games from different genres and eras. "Kameo," released in 2005 for the Xbox 360, is an action-adventure game featuring a fairy with the ability to transform into different elemental creatures. In contrast, "Mafia," released in 2002, is an open-world action-adventure game set in a fictional city during the 1930s, focusing on organized crime. Both games have their unique appeal but cater to different gaming preferences.
